Empowering researchers in the SciLifeLab Train-the-Trainer Programme

Earlier this April, the SciLifeLab Train-the-Trainer course took place at the SciLifeLab Lund site. Train-the-Trainer is a comprehensive course designed to upskill researchers in the topics of training and learning.

Scientific Training Officers Jill Jaworski and colleague Kristen Schroeder successfully capacity-built yet another group of engaged and highly motivated researchers in this latest edition of the Train-the-Trainer programme. Researchers came from across Sweden to learn about how learning works, assessment and motivation/demotivation, mentorship practices and more. The SciLifeLab Training Hub is organizing the training programmes.

“Every researcher and subject-matter expert is a trainer in the making,” says Jessica Lindvall, Head of Training at SciLifeLab and lead of the Training Hub.

“The knowledge about how learning works and to ensure quality to your training activities are key skills. Both when designing, developing, and delivering training as well as in your daily life where we constantly, as experts, train and learn from each other. By training ourselves on how to ensure learning is happening, we create impact, sustainability and quality to our work,” Jessica elaborates.

Scientific Training Officer Jill Jaworski at the Train-the-Trainer course
From fundamental learning principles to mastering engagement strategies

In this edition, 10 participants from across Sweden came together for a 3-day intensive course. From exploring fundamental learning principles to mastering engagement strategies. The Train-the-Trainer course contains modules that cover session planning, material creation, active teaching techniques, and constructive feedback methods. The prime objective remains to render researchers capable of leveraging the latest educational insights to foster meaningful learning experiences, both for their training activities as well as to incorporate into their daily working life as researchers.

A big highlight of this year’s course was the focus on dynamic course material design and engagement methods that better support different types of learners. In her reflection on the importance of tailored teaching, Jill Jaworski said, “Our mission is to transform not only how we as trainers train but also how we as learners learn, creating a resonant educational experience. By considering the unique learning journeys of each individual, we can craft sessions that suit learners individually and as groups, and the topics and contexts being shared.”
